COURSE INFORMATION FOR CURRENT SEMESTER/TERM



           Techning Schedule



                                                                                        References/Teaching
                Week                  Lecture Topics/Tutorial/Assignment
                                                                                              Materials
                 1        Kinematics of particles:  rectilinear motion and curvilinear mo-  Notes, Reference texts
                          tion

                  2       Kinematics of particles: dependent and relative motion    Notes, Reference texts


                  3       Kinetics of particles:  force and acceleration, Newton’s second   Notes, Reference texts
                          law of motion, equation of motion with different coordinate sys-
                          tems

                  4       Kinetics of particles: work and energy methods            Notes, Reference texts

                  5       Kinetics of particles: work and energy methods            Notes, Reference texts


                  6       Kinetics of particles: work and energy methods            Notes, Reference texts

                  7       Kinetics of particles: linear impulse and linear momentum, an-  Notes, Reference texts
                          gular impulse and angular momentum, steady fluid streams.

                  8       Kinematics of rigid bodies in the plane:  translation and angular   Notes, Reference texts
                          motion about a fixed axis, and absolute motion analysis

                  9       Kinematics of rigid bodies in the plane: relative motion analysis-  Notes, Reference texts
                          velocity, and instantaneous centre of zero velocity


                 10       Kinematics of rigid bodies in the plane: relative motion analysis-  Notes, Reference texts
                          acceleration
                 11       Kinetics of rigid bodies: mass moment of inertia, equation of   Notes, Reference texts
                          motion with different coordinate systems

                 12       Kinetics of rigid bodies: work and energy                 Notes, Reference texts


                 13       Kinetics of rigid bodies: linear impulse and linear momentum,   Notes, Reference texts
                          angular impulse and angular momentum

                 14       Three-dimensional kinematics of a rigid body: rotation about a   Notes, Reference texts
                          fixed point, and general motion
